Alex Tuch is heading to Washington as the Capitals jumped the line for the top free agent available, and the Buffalo Sabres got something in return for a player they knew was not coming back.

The Capitals got Tuch in a sign-and-trade Wednesday, getting him after the Sabres inked him to an eight-year $84 million US contract and dealt him for a 2027 third-round pick and the rights to pending free-agent forward David Kampf. Tuch will count $10.5 million against the salary cap through the 2033-34 NHL season.

“Alex was a highly coveted player, and we are pleased that he chose to come to Washington,” Capitals general manager Chris Patrick said. “Alex is a top-six offensive forward who brings size, versatility and the ability to contribute in all situations.”

Tuch, 30, essentially orchestrated the deal by agreeing to go and benefited from the way the trade went down by getting an eight-year contract, as opposed to the limit of seven had he hit the open market next week.

It is Washington’s second big addition in two days after acquiring winger Jordan Kyrou from St. Louis for the No. 16 pick in the draft, prospect Milton Gastrin and forward Connor McMichael. It is also Buffalo’s second subtraction from its roster after sending defenceman Bo Byram to Chicago in a trade the Sabres acquired the No. 4 pick in the draft they’re hosting this weekend.

The Sabres locked up an important player for the long term by signing Zach Benson to a seven-year contract worth $52.5 million. GM Jarmo Kekalainen called getting a deal done with Benson a priority after the 21-year-old agitating winger’s productive playoff performance.

Also Wednesday, Nashville and Colorado made another swap, with the Predators getting Jack Drury, prospect Chase Bradley and a 2029 third-round pick for fellow forwards Zachary L’Heureux and Fedor Svechkov. It’s the second trade between the teams since Chris MacFarland left his post as Avalanche GM to take over control of the Preds’ hockey operations department in early June.

“Jack Drury is a hard-working, reliable, full-sheet of the ice centre who can handle the tough assignments while being elite in the faceoff circle,” MacFarland said. “His addition to our forward group bolsters our depth in the middle of the ice, and we’re thrilled to have him.”

More moves are expected in the leadup to the first round of the draft Friday in Buffalo at 7 p.m. ET and with free agency on the horizon next week.

“Sunday, the ball started to roll and now everybody’s on the treadmill,” Blue general manager Doug Armstrong said on a call with reporters. “It’s gone from a nice leisurely 2.5 walk [to] probably a 4.5 walk today and there’ll probably be a 6 jog tomorrow and an 8 run on Friday.”

San Jose GM Mike Grier, whose trading of young forward William Eklund to Ottawa for the No. 9 pick suggests the Sharks are not done dealing, observed that there is a lot of movement happening around the league. The salary cap is increasing to $104 million.

“The cap’s going up: Teams have money to spend, for the most part, for the first time in a while,” Grier said. “On top of that, I think free agent market, the free agent class, this year might not excite a lot of people, so I think that’s leading to a lot trades and people being open to trying to improve their teams in different ways. There’s some good players out there, but prices are high.”

Kekalainen said there had been no progress in contract talks with Tuch, who is coming off a season with 33 goals and 33 assists. The sign-and-trade allowed Tuch to get an eight-year deal, whereas he would have been limited to seven in free agency.

Like Tuch, Kekalainen said there was no movement with Byram, who he said expressed no interest in wanting to remain with the Sabres after his current contract expired next summeer.
